The Versatile Use Of Steel Shims In Various Industries

steel shims are simple yet highly versatile tools used in a wide range of industries for various applications. These thin, flat pieces of steel play a crucial role in filling gaps, aligning components, adjusting height, and providing support in machinery, construction, automotive, and other fields. The durability, strength, and precision of steel shims make them an essential component in many projects where precise adjustments are required.

In the construction industry, steel shims are commonly used to level and align structural components such as beams, columns, and trusses. When installing windows, doors, or cabinets, steel shims are used to ensure proper alignment and support. By placing steel shims between the surfaces, construction workers can adjust the height and angle of the components to achieve a perfect fit. This helps prevent issues such as sagging, uneven surfaces, or gaps between the structures.

In the automotive industry, steel shims play a vital role in ensuring the smooth operation of vehicles. During the assembly of engines, transmissions, and other components, steel shims are used to adjust clearances, eliminate play, and reduce vibration. By placing steel shims in strategic locations, automotive technicians can fine-tune the performance of various systems and improve overall efficiency. steel shims are also used for brake pad adjustment, wheel alignment, and suspension tuning, helping to enhance the safety and performance of vehicles.

In the manufacturing sector, steel shims are widely used in machinery and equipment maintenance. From aligning rollers in conveyor systems to adjusting heights in packaging machines, steel shims provide a cost-effective solution for achieving precision and accuracy. By using steel shims of different thicknesses, operators can make small adjustments in tight spaces without the need for expensive modifications or replacements. This versatility makes steel shims a valuable tool for improving productivity and reducing downtime in manufacturing facilities.

The aerospace industry also relies on steel shims for critical applications that require high precision and exceptional durability. Aircraft components such as control surfaces, landing gear, and engine mounts often require precise adjustments to ensure optimal performance and safety. steel shims are used to fill gaps, provide support, and maintain alignment in these complex systems. The strength and reliability of steel shims make them ideal for withstanding extreme conditions such as high temperatures, vibration, and pressure changes that aircraft encounter during flight.

In the field of electronics and telecommunications, steel shims are used to support and align delicate components in devices such as smartphones, computers, and satellite equipment. By placing steel shims under circuit boards, connectors, or antennas, technicians can ensure proper contact, reduce interference, and improve signal quality. Steel shims are also used in the assembly of optical devices, sensors, and precision instruments where tight tolerances are critical for accurate performance. The ability of steel shims to provide stability and support in electronic applications makes them essential for achieving reliable connections and minimizing signal loss.

Beyond their industrial applications, steel shims are also used in everyday household items such as furniture, appliances, and plumbing fixtures. When installing cabinets, shelves, or countertops, steel shims can help level and stabilize the structures to prevent wobbling or sagging. In plumbing installations, steel shims are used to support pipes, fixtures, and fittings to ensure proper alignment and prevent leaks. The versatility and affordability of steel shims make them a handy tool for DIY enthusiasts and homeowners looking to make small adjustments and improvements around the house.
